WILLIAM VANCE XIII Secret défense (T.14), Dargaud 2000 Original cover of the first edition. Signed. Mixed media on paper 37.5 × 49.9 cm (14.76 × 19.65 in.) The album Secret Défense was a surprise when it was released in 2000. Everyone thought that XIII was ending with its 13th episode and that the album L'Enquête, a sort of Companion Book illuminating the saga, served as its conclusion. A big mistake. XIII escapes thanks to Jessica Martin, who is seen here in majesty, a killer who plays a double game and from whom the hero with the white temple will have difficulty to get rid of. This cover - XIII covers on the market have become rare - is of a rather simple composition: the hero's face overhangs Jessica's silhouette in an opposition between warm (XIII) and cold (the slayer) colors. This kind of close-up is always perilous but fortunately William Vance, who received a good advertising training when Photoshop hardly existed, manages it brilliantly.
